Nearly 60,600 households in Romania still not connected to electricity

29 July 2011

Romania would have to pay around EUR 211 million to connect the remaining 60,600 households to electricity, according to the development director of Electrica SA, Marian Geanta, quoted by Mediafax newswire. In the Romanian rural area 60,584 households in 2,100 villages are not connected to electricity.

In the areas served by Romanian Electrica SA and its subsidiaries there are 32,223 households without electricity, in 1,071 villages, while in areas where the private energy suppliers operate, like E. ON, CEZ and Enel, 28,361 households don't have access to electricity, in 1,029 villages.

The counties with the most households without electricity are Harghita, Alba and Caras-Severin, according to Marian Geanta.
